The Biggie Pack Ultra is an ultralight yet durable frameless backpack for weekend hikes. If you've been into ultralight backpacking for a while and have your gear finely tuned, you can handle even long-distance trails with it. The backpack is made from durable and waterproof Ecopak™ EPL Ultra 200 material.

The Biggie Pack offers you a simple, proven design, 7 spacious external pockets, waterproof material, loops for attaching bungee cords, load-lifter straps, and a range of other features.

The fact that the back of the backpack is not reinforced with a solid frame is both an advantage and a disadvantage. The main advantage is the weight savings on a part of the backpack that is not completely necessary. However, one must pay more attention when packing things into the backpack to prevent sharp objects from digging into their back. If you pack the backpack well, it is really comfortable. With a little practice, it will become easy for you, and you will perceive the lack of a frame as a great positive.
Thanks to the frameless construction and minimalist design, the weight of the backpack has reached an incredible 520 grams.
We have found it effective to place a folded inflatable sleeping pad in a rectangle against the back of the backpack, seat pad or thin EVA foam sleeping pad.
The second option for ensuring comfortable back support is to attach a seat pad or a folded foam sleeping pad externally to the backpack, using elastic cords that you can secure to the loops on the sides of the backpack. This way, you create external padding and will always have the seat pad at hand.
The manufacturer states the backpack's load capacity is 12 kg. For maximum comfort, we would recommend keeping the weight around 10 kg. For this reason, the backpack is more suitable for more experienced hikers with well-tuned ultralight gear list.

Minimalist design – the backpack has one main compartment with roll-top closure and a cross strap for additional compression or gear attachment. This allows you to easily adjust the height of the backpack based on its fill.
Wide shoulder straps – especially with a frameless backpack, you will appreciate the wide, comfortable, and pleasantly padded shoulder straps. The padding is covered with a stretchy fabric that does not damage membrane clothing.
Side pockets – the pockets on the sides are made of the same material as the body of the backpack and can easily hold a 2-liter bottle. They have an elastic rim at the top, so the contents do not fall out. At the bottom of the pockets, you will find a drainage hole to prevent water from collecting there during rain.
Sturdy kangaroo pocket – on the front of the backpack, there is a spacious pocket made of durable ULTRA material. It is ideal for a waterproof jacket, toilet trowel, tent stakes, and similar gear. Additionally, the elastic drawstrings on the outside of this pocket provide another option for attaching lightweight gear/clothing. You can easily remove the cords and leave it at home or attach it elsewhere.
Attachment of the foam sleeping pad – on the bottom side, the backpack has 2 paracords with a Lineloc tightening component prepared. You can easily attach a foam sleeping pad or other gear.

Comfortable hip belt with pockets – spacious pockets on the hip belt measuring 18 cm can hold even larger smartphones. The zippers on these pockets are waterproof. In the right pocket, there is also a clip for attaching keys.
Mesh pockets on the shoulder straps – on both shoulder straps, you will find a spacious pocket made of durable mesh fabric. These pockets are perfect for a small smartphone, sunglasses, snacks, tissues, and other small items you want to have within easy reach.
Side drawcords – for attaching equipment to the sides, such as trekking poles, foam sleeping pads, etc., the drawcords with Lineloc can be useful.
Compatibility with hydration bladders – inside the backpack, there is a loop for hanging the hydration bladder, and between the shoulder straps, you will find a hole for the drinking tube.
Adjustable chest strap – you can slide the chest strap up and down, or you can remove it and leave it at home if needed.

The backpack is constructed from Ecopak™ EPL Ultra 200 material. Stretch pockets are made of durable nylon, zippers from YKK, and buckles from Woojin Plastic.
Ecopak™ EPL Ultra 200 is a new line of waterproof fabrics for backpacks made of 67% woven UHMWPE (Ultra-high-molecular-weight polyethylene – unbranded dyneema fiber) and 33% recycled polyester blend Repreve. This layer is then laminated to a thin 0,5 mil RUV recycled film. It is one of the strongest laminated materials for lightweight backpacks currently available on the market.
UHMWPE has a remarkable strength-to-weight ratio, making it the strongest fiber in the world. The fibers are 15x stronger than high-quality steel, lightweight, abrasion-resistant, waterproof, and resistant to UV radiation and chemicals. The main material of the backpack is 100% waterproof, but please note that the seams of the backpack are not sealed. This means that the backpack is not fully waterproof.
In addition to its great properties, this fabric stands out for its low environmental impact and high content of recycled materials. The patented backing made from recycled Challenge RUV film is 100% recycled and 97% UV resistant. Every meter of ECOPAK™ fabric saves more than 0,5 kg of CO2 compared to nylon fabric. ECOPAK™ contains no harmful TPU, PVC, DWR, or other coatings. The CO2 emissions in the production of recycled polyester Repreve are 50% lower than those of nylon and comparable to organic cotton.
Material properties: weight – 119 g/m²; waterproofness – 200+ psi (13,8+ bar); abrasion resistance ASTM 3884 – 4 400 cycles; fabric tear strength ASTM D2261 – 470 N / 47 kg (warp), 600 N / 60 kg (fill)
